Linux| 命令执行成功与错误以及错误码|linux目录

2023-12-20 08:44:51
"OS error code   1:  Operation not permitted"
 "OS error code   2:  No such file or directory"
 "OS error code   3:  No such process"
 "OS error code   4:  Interrupted system call"
 "OS error code   5:  Input/output error"
 "OS error code   6:  No such device or address"
 "OS error code   7:  Argument list too long"
 "OS error code   8:  Exec format error"
 "OS error code   9:  Bad file descriptor"
 "OS error code  10:  No child processes"
 "OS error code  11:  Resource temporarily unavailable"
 "OS error code  12:  Cannot allocate memory"
  "OS error code  13:  Permission denied" 

0 执行成功
1 操作不允许
2 没有此文件或目录
3 进程不存在
4  系统调用终端
5 I/O错误
6 无此设备或地址
7 参数列表过长
8 执行命令格式错误
9 错误的文件描述
10 不存在子进程
11 暂时性缺少资源
12 无法分配内存空间
13 权限拒绝

直接给结论,执行成功 返回值为0 错误就反悔错误码
常见的错误码, 没有此文件或目录、权限拒绝、无法分配内存空间

===================================================

#linux 目录 
etc
/etc/resolv.conf 是DNS配置文件。在网卡配置文件中进行配置,默认情况下 网卡配置文件DNS优先于/etc/resolv.conf。 
  /etc/hostname 在Centos 7,配置主机名,查看修改。 
  /etc/hosts  ip与域名对应关系 ,解析域名(主机名),用/etc/hosts搭建网站的测试环境 (虚拟机)。不同服务器之间相互访问。 
  /etc/gateways 设置路由器 
  /etc/fstab  file system table :文件系统挂载表,开机的时候设备与入口对应关系 开机自动挂载列表。 
  /etc/rc.local  开机自启 
  /etc/inittab(centos 6)运行级别的配置文件 
  /etc/profile 环境变量配置文件 
  /etc/bashrc 命令别名 
  /etc/motd  文件中的内容 会在用户登录系统之后显示出来  
  /etc/issue /etc/issue.net 文件中的内容 会在用户登录系统之前显示出来

hosts文件是Linux系统上一个负责ip地址与域名快速解析的文件,以ascii格式保存在/etc/目录下。hosts文件包含了ip地址与主机名之间的映射,还包括主机的别名。在没有域名解析服务器的情况下,系统上的所有网络程序都通过查询该文件来解析对应于某个主机名的ip地址,否则就需要使用dns服务程序来解决。通过可以将常用的域名和ip地址映射加入到hosts文件中,实现快速方便的访问。

注意:/etc/hosts和/etc/hostname 后者是配置主机名,而主机名主要是用来标识主机

########################################################

#目录 基础
/bin: 存放二进制可执行文件(ls、cat、mkdir 等),常用命令一般都在这里;
/etc: 存放系统管理和配置文件;
/home: 存放所有用户文件的根目录,是用户主目录的基点,比如用户 user 的主目录就是/home/user,可以用~user 表示;
/usr : 用于存放系统应用程序;
/opt: 额外安装的可选应用程序包所放置的位置。一般情况下,我们可以把 tomcat 等都安装到这里;
/proc: 虚拟文件系统目录,是系统内存的映射。可直接访问这个目录来获取系统信息;
/root: 超级用户(系统管理员)的主目录;
/sbin:存放二进制可执行文件,只有 root 才能访问。这里存放的是系统管理员使用的系统级别的管理命令和程序。如 ifconfig 等;
/dev: 用于存放设备文件;
/mnt: 系统管理员安装临时文件系统的安装点,系统提供这个目录是让用户临时挂载其他的文件系统;
/boot: 存放用于系统引导时使用的各种文件;
/lib : 存放着和系统运行相关的库文件 ;
/tmp: 用于存放各种临时文件,是公用的临时文件存储点;
/var: 用于存放运行时需要改变数据的文件,也是某些大文件的溢出区,比方说各种服务的日志文件(系统启动日志等。)等;

##################################################

文章来源:https://blog.csdn.net/ttxiaoxiaobai/article/details/135074839
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。